Trail La Cascada of Cimbarra.

La Cascada of Cimbarra is starting by car from the Visitor Center, than take the N-IV to Madrid up to the diversion to Aldeaquemada (approx. about 5 km.. Continue the road until Aldeaquemada (approx. approximately 30 km.), Once in the village go to the right and after a while you will see the real starting pint of the trail. From this point, and following a narrow trail, which is paved in some sections and which must pass with care because of the proximity of numerous rock cut, and arrive in the so-called Plaza de Armas, a small rocky plateau where There are two viewpoints: One of the waterfall on the Cimbarra impressive waterfall of about 40 m, formed by the river Guarrizas taking advantage of the existence of a failure of reverse type, the other is much smaller and provides views of the gorge that has formed as a result of erosion remontante produced by the river, erosion has also given rise to the formation of pools in the bedrock.
From the Plaza de Armas continues along a path along the mountain between vegetation closed jarales and holm oak woods from which have excellent views of the hill Piedras Blancas and Arroyo of Martin Perez, right, and that leads to the top of Path.
